Jump to letter: [
          
            ABCDEFGKLMOSVX
          ]
        
        live555: LIVE555 Streaming Media
        
        
            | Name: | live555 | Vendor: | VideoLAN Project (http://www.videolan.org) | 
        
            | Version: | 2009.07.28 | License: | LGPL | 
        
            | Release: | 1.3 | URL: |  | 
        
        
        - Summary
- This code forms a set of C++ libraries for multimedia streaming,
using open standard protocols (RTP/RTCP, RTSP, SIP). These libraries
can be used to build streaming applications
            Arch: src
            
                | Download: | live555-2009.07.28-1.3.src.rpm | 
|---|
                | Build Date: | Sun Aug  1 15:57:09 2010 | 
|---|
                | Packager: | Dominique Leuenberger <dominique-rpm{%}leuenberger{*}net> | 
|---|
                | Size: | 340 KiB | 
|---|
            
         
            Arch: i586
            
                | Download: | live555-2009.07.28-1.3.i586.rpm | 
|---|
                | Build Date: | Sun Aug  1 16:05:57 2010 | 
|---|
                | Packager: | Dominique Leuenberger <dominique-rpm{%}leuenberger{*}net> | 
|---|
                | Size: | 2.00 MiB | 
|---|
            
         
        Changelog
        
            - * Sun Apr 26 14:00:00 2009 [email protected]
- 2009.04.20:
- Fixed "BasicUsageEnvironment::getErrno()" to always (under Windows) return
  "WSAGetLastError()" (and to just ignore the "errno" variable>.
  Also fixed a few places in the code where we were still using "errno"
  instead of calling "getErrno()"
  2009.04.07:
- Changed many "char*" variables to "char const*" to eliminate possible compiler warnings.
  (Thanks to Sebastien Escudier for pointing out this issue.)
  2009.04.06:
- Modified our Windows-only version of "gettimeofday()" so that it now returns times based on the proper epoch.
  (Thanks to Patrick White for this suggestion.)
- Created a new config file for 64-bit Solaris, and renamed the old "config.solaris" file to make it
  clear that it's for 32-bit Solaris only.  (Thanks to ichael Skaastrup.)
- Modified "config.mingw" to add "-DLOCALE_NOT_USED" to the "COMPILE_OPTS =" line.  (The VLC folks seem to want
  this.)
- Made a minor change to some win32-specific code in "RTSPClient.cpp" that the VLC folks seem to like.
  (However, "RTSPClient" is about to undergo a major overhaul (for asynchronous I/O) anyway...)
- Made a small change to "mediaServer/DynamicRTSPServer.cpp" to eliminate compiler warnings on some platforms. 
            - * Tue Sep  1 14:00:00 2009 [email protected]
- 2009.07.28:
- Updated "QuickTimeFileSink" to add a "stss" atom for video streams, following a suggestion by Gerardo Ares.
  (At present we just 'guess' which video 'samples' (frames) are 'key frames', so this might not work properly on some
  video streams.)
- Modified the "config.uClinux" configuration file, following a suggestion by Chetan Raj.
- Changed "RTSPClient"s implementation of the RTSP "TEARDOWN" command to always act as if the command succeeded, regardless of
  the actual response from the server (because, from the client's point of view, the session has ended).
  (This overcomes a potential memory leak, pointer out by Stuart Rawling.)
  2009.07.09:
- Modified the RTSP server implementation to - for streams where there is a known duration - always include a range end time
  in the RTSP "PLAY" response, even if the client did not specify one in the "PLAY" request.  This allows VLC's client
  'trick play' to (mostly) work.
- Updated "MediaSession::initiate()" to eliminate a possible memory leak if we get an error in socket creation.
  (Thanks to Denis Charmet.)
- Made a minor change to "MultiFramedRTPSink" to make monitoring/debugging easier.  (Thanks to Guy Bonneau.)
- Begun adding support for DV video.  However, this implementation is still incomplete.  DO NOT USE IT!
  2009.06.02:
- Updated the MPEG Transport Stream multiplexor implementation to allow for H.264 video.  (Thanks to Massimo Zito.)
- Updated "MultiFramedRTPSink" to allow for subclasses for RTP payload formats (such as DV, coming soon) that impose
  a granularity on RTP fragment sizes.